A vector is defined by the program and tools used to make it, not by image style.
If you used Photoshop's pen tool/paths, Illustrator, Flash/Freehand, Sodipodi or Xara to make it, these are all vector tools, and using these tools would create a vector image.
Otherwise the image would not be considered a vector.

Yep. Like what Tama-Neko said. There are many known ways to filter an image to make it look like a vector. I can't say for sure unless I know the tool used to create the image.
